The Thermo Scientific™ Varioskan™ LUX Multimode Microplate Reader (VLB000D0) is an advanced and reliable dual-optics microplate reader designed for bioscience, pharmaceutical, and life science researchers requiring flexible detection for absorbance and fluorescence assays.

With both top and bottom reading modes, the Varioskan LUX ensures optimal signal detection across a wide range of assays, including protein quantification, enzyme kinetics, fluorescence-based cellular assays, and DNA/RNA analysis.

This compact, modular system features automatic dynamic range selection, smart safety controls, and an intuitive SkanIt™ Software interface, streamlining data acquisition and minimizing user error while ensuring reproducible results every time.

Key Features and Benefits

1. Dual Detection and Reading Flexibility

  • Absorbance (UV-Vis) and Fluorescence Intensity detection in one instrument.
  • Top and bottom reading options optimize detection for cell-based and solution assays.
  • Double monochromator optics for precise wavelength selection and assay versatility.
  • Spectral scanning for rapid assay optimization and wavelength characterization.
  • Compatible with 6–1536 well plates and μDrop plates for small-volume assays.

2. Performance and Efficiency

  • High sensitivity:
    • Top fluorescence reading: <0.4 fmol fluorescein/well.
    • Bottom fluorescence reading: <4 fmol fluorescein/well.
  • Fast measurement speed: 15 s (96-well), 45 s (384-well), and 135 s (1536-well).
  • Dynamic range: >6 decades (top) and >5.5 decades (bottom).
  • Precision: SD <0.001 Abs or CV <0.5% at 450 nm.
  • Photometric accuracy: ±2% (200–399 nm, 0–2 Abs); ±1% (400–1000 nm, 0–3 Abs).
  • Linearity: ±2% across 0–4 Abs (96-well) and 0–3 Abs (384-well).

3. Smart Automation and Safety

  • Automatic dynamic range selection per well ensures optimal signal detection.
  • Automated calibration and self-diagnostics guarantee long-term accuracy.
  • Smart safety controls alert users to potential issues before they occur.
  • Orbital shaking and temperature control (ambient +4°C to 45°C) maintain assay consistency.

4. Powerful SkanIt™ Software

  • SkanIt™ Research Edition included, with a license-free multi-user installation.
  • Virtual Pipetting Tool for quick and accurate plate setup.
  • Real-time spectral and kinetic data visualization.
  • Automatic data saving prevents loss from unexpected interruptions.
  • Built-in analysis tools: Blank subtraction, standard curve, dose-response, kinetic, and spectral analysis.
  • Flexible export options: *.xlsx, *.pdf, *.xml, and *.txt file formats.
  • Traceable reports with full runtime action documentation.

5. Certified and Upgradeable

  • HTRF™ certified by Cisbio Bioassays.
  • DLReady™ validated by Promega Corporation.
  • Modular, upgradeable platform for future addition of luminescence, AlphaScreen™, and time-resolved fluorescence technologies.

Technical Specifications

ParameterSpecification
Measurement TechnologiesAbsorbance, Fluorescence Intensity
Reading OptionsTop and Bottom
Wavelength RangeAbsorbance: 200–1000 nm; Fluorescence Excitation: 200–822 nm; Emission: 270–840 nm
Measurement Speed15 s (96-well), 45 s (384-well), 135 s (1536-well)
Dynamic RangeFluorescence Intensity: Top >6 decades, Bottom >5.5 decades
Sensitivity<0.4 fmol fluorescein/well (top), <4 fmol fluorescein/well (bottom)
Accuracy (Photometric)±2% (200–399 nm), ±1% (400–1000 nm)
PrecisionSD <0.001 Abs or CV <0.5% at 450 nm
Linearity±2% (96-well 0–4 Abs; 384-well 0–3 Abs at 450 nm)
Spectral Scanning Speed<2.2 s/well (400–500 nm, 1 flash, 2 nm step)
Light SourceXenon Flash Lamp
Detector TypePhotomultiplier Tube (PMT)
Incubation TemperatureAmbient +4°C to 45°C
ShakingOrbital
InterfacePC Software (SkanIt™ Software)
Software LanguagesEnglish, French, German, Spanish, Portuguese, Italian, Japanese, Chinese
Dimensions (W × D × H)53 × 58 × 51 cm (21 × 23 × 20 in)
Weight54 kg (119 lb)
Power Requirements100–240 V, 50/60 Hz
Plate Compatibility6–1536 well plates; μDrop plates
Software TypeSkanIt™ PC Software, Research Edition

Applications

  • Absorbance Assays: Nucleic acid (DNA/RNA) and protein quantification.
  • Fluorescence Assays: FRET, GFP, and fluorophore-based molecular interaction studies.
  • Enzyme Kinetics: Reaction rate and inhibition analysis.
  • Protein and Biomolecule Analysis: BCA, Bradford, and Lowry assays.
  • Cell-Based Assays: Reporter gene expression, cell proliferation, and cytotoxicity.
  • Spectral Scanning: Optimization of excitation/emission wavelengths.
  • High-Throughput Screening: Multi-well kinetic and endpoint analysis.
